The Estate: Next to the NTU Experimental Forest, Meifeng, Hehuanshan
Located just above Cingjing and right next to the National Taiwan University (NTU) Experimental Forest, this estate sits at the absolute highest altitude within the entire Cingjing tea region. Beyond its extreme elevation, the plantation boasts world-class management. Because the estate manager lives right on-site, every detail—from fertilization and irrigation to pest control—is executed to absolute perfection.
Pristine Isolation: Zero Contamination for Export-Grade Quality
Another exceptional advantage of this tea garden is that it shares no borders with neighboring vegetable farms. The Cingjing area is filled with vegetable plots alongside tea gardens. Coordinating pesticide standards between the two is notoriously difficult, which often raises concerns about agricultural chemicals drifting onto the tea leaves. In the past, we have found high-quality teas nearby, but always felt hesitant upon seeing massive vegetable fields right next door—especially since we export to foreign markets, where pesticide compliance must be absolutely flawless.
Fortunately, this tea garden has zero issues with that. Surrounded entirely by lush, natural forest, there is absolutely no risk of chemical drift!
A Peak Altitude of 2,050 Meters
The highest point of this tea garden reaches an impressive 2,050 meters. Don’t underestimate this elevation; at 2,050 meters, very few competitors can match it outside of legendary terroirs like Fushoushan, Huagang, and Dayuling. This superb alpine environment, coupled with excellent sunlight exposure, creates a truly distinctive and unparalleled High-Mountain Lhuan (terroir flavor).
